MD5 kryptering er en algoritme, der bruges til at konvertere data til en unik streng af tegn. Denne streng kaldes en hash og bruges ofte til at sikre dataintegriteten. I denne artikel vil vi give en detaljeret forklaring på, hvordan MD5 kryptering fungerer.
MD5 står for Message Digest Algorithm 5. Det er en populær hashfunktion, der tager en vilkårlig mængde data som input og genererer en 128-bit hashværdi som output. Denne hashværdi er unik for hvert sæt inputdata og bruges ofte til at sikre, at data ikke er blevet ændret eller beskadiget under overførsel eller opbevaring.
MD5 algoritmen behandler inputdata blok for blok og genererer en hashværdi baseret på indholdet af hver blok. Den starter med en initial hashværdi og kombinerer derefter blokkens data med den aktuelle hashværdi ved hjælp af en række logiske operationer.
MD5 kryptering bruges i mange applikationer og systemer til forskellige formål. Nogle af de mest almindelige anvendelser inkluderer:
Selvom MD5 kryptering har været populær i mange år, er der nogle sikkerhedsbekymringer ved denne algoritme. MD5 er kendt for at have visse sårbarheder, der gør det muligt for angribere at generere kollisioner, hvor to forskellige inputblokke producerer den samme hashværdi. Derfor er det ikke længere anbefalet at bruge MD5 som en sikker hashfunktion.
MD5 kryptering er en algoritme, der genererer unikke hashværdier for inputdata. Selvom MD5 har været populær i mange år, er det vigtigt at bemærke dens sikkerhedsbekymringer og begrænsninger. I stedet anbefales det at bruge mere sikre hashfunktioner som SHA-256 eller SHA-3 til krypteringsformål.
Kommentarer (0)